Harry gave a speech and was later joined on stage by his pregnant wife, who made a surprise appearance after not originally being expected to attend.

Britain's Prince Harry and Meghan, Duchess of Sussex, attend the WE Day UK event at the SSE Arena in Wembley, London, on Wednesday.

Prince Harry and Duchess Meghan joined celebrities including model Naomi Campbell and singer Liam Payne on Wednesday at an event celebrating young people’s involvement in bringing about positive social change.
